When I would bring in all the mobs to the area and I was more or less sure that they had all come to the spot to be kited, I would turn my sound up all the way (so it is easier to listen to how loud the footsteps were to gauge how close the mobs are), turn down my clip plane to 10% or so, I'd turn off NPC names, and I would turn the spell Opacity to 0%. Also, I turned off completely DoT damage in the Filters section so I wouldn't get a giant influx of text every tick (which seemed to give me a bit of a lag spike). This way the only indicator I see of the mobs being dotted is "Soandso winces" or whatever it is and of course the playing of the instrument. Even after all of this, I would get not so much network lag but if I wasn't careful I would end up turning very sharply because that many mobs for whatever reason kills frames. But for me it wouldn't kill frames in lowering the frames uniformly it would be more like spikes that would come. It felt like driving in a shitty car at like 100+ mph, where it gets kind of shaky. Also, I would make buttons so each time I would go to cast my dot, it would hide all the corpses. This way there are less things to possibly lag me and I could avoid accidentally looting while turning.
By level 31 or so, you should be able to kill all of the drolvargs in FV. I think around level 28 there were some that were too high. I would do an entire kite and check and some of the snarlers were at 100% health. By 30 or 31, you should be good to go.
